Choosing the right eCommerce platform for your online store isn't only vital to the appearance and message that you want to visually achieve, but it is also imperative to your sales. Think about your personal shopping experience. The first thing that you do when you click onto a website or take a step into a new store is take notice of the appearance of the brand, clothing and company. Whether subconsciously or not, your brain begins to process and judge the image that you are viewing which allows you to make the decision as to whether or not this is a place that you would like to continue your shopping with. Within seconds, you have instantly made a decision and judgement of the brand - all due to physical appearance. At first, it has nothing to do with the prices, quality of your items or the style of them. It has to do with the look of your brand and company, and this is exactly why choosing the right eCommerce platform is one of the most important decisions you will have to face.
